Enjoy this talk by Dr. Ben Akers at a one-day men's retreat for the Denver chapter of Legatus. In this important talk, Dr. Akers discusses the theological virtue of hope to two extremes to be avoided. His talk include an examination of the work of art: Chest Players by Friedrich Retzsch.
